High-TG Waterborne Acrylic Film-forming Emulsion
WQ-293 is a high-TG waterborne acrylic film-forming emulsion with narrow particle size distribution and excellent adhesion. It features low foaming, excellent flowability, high gloss, good wear resistance, fast drying, low odor, and good compatibility with waterborne acrylic resins and emulsions.
Physical Properties
Properties Units Values
Appearance --- Milky white liquid with a bluish tint
Viscosity (25℃) cps 1100-2500
Solid Content % 46±1
pH --- 7.5-8.5
Tg 105
Performance Features
  • Excellent wettability and dispersibility
  • Good printing stability
  • Compatible with popular water-based resins in the market
  • Low odor
Packaging and Storage
  • Plastic drum, net weight: 50 kg/drum, 200 kg/drum
  • Store in a cool, closed place with anti-freezing protection
  • Recommended for use within a short period after opening
